The ruling All Progressives Congress, according to the Peoples Democratic Party, has grown numb to the violence and bloodshed that has become commonplace in Nigeria.

It also stated that the APC has demonstrated that it is not a political party but rather a collection of odd bedfellows.

Debo Ologun-Agba, the PDP’s new National Publicity Secretary, stated this in an interview with journalists in Abuja.

“…about numbness to violence, numbness to bloodshed,” he said. True leadership will not take a vacation during a crisis, no matter where it is found in the world.

“When a country is destroyed, the president of that country is expected to act as a consoler-in-chief. However, there is a complete lack of leadership in Nigeria. That is why 40,50 people die every day and it appears to be a normal occurrence. What an irony: we have a leadership that has gone on vacation, and Nigeria is disintegrating under the leadership of a retired general.

“A president who is unconcerned,” he continued. When people are killed, instead of sympathizing with them, they blame them. You may recall farmers who were murdered on their farms some time ago; it was claimed that they were denied permission to visit their farms. What kind of inhumane people do we have in positions of power?

“That’s why you notice that everything they do is in line with their perplexity.” Because they are odd bedfellows, lacking in consensus, ideology, common purpose, and mission. As a result, bringing them together is extremely difficult. There is an unbridgeable chasm between them.”

On the other hand, according to Ologun-Agba, the PDP has shown that it has what it takes to get Nigeria back on track.
